Output 8e75e839bd7a7d5d2ed29d8e279131f569ce86d827c1718885d61cdf2c305d9f:0

value
302312136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df4ab4bf2bb454d4e4bb7d307ecb3aa4be4f455 OP_EQUAL
address
32xoowrVtdPfY8BcktBALrxbDtqFabMnAB
transaction
8e75e839bd7a7d5d2ed29d8e279131f569ce86d827c1718885d61cdf2c305d9f
spent
true